Best Ingredients in Night Creams for Aging Skin
The best products contain proven anti-ageing ingredients.
Anti-Aging Ingredients
- Retinol
- Peptides
- Vitamin C
- Antioxidants
- Retinyl Palmitate
These ingredients target wrinkles, fine lines, and dullness.
Hydrating Ingredients
- Hyaluronic acid
- Glycerin
- Shea butter
- Squalane
- Vitamin E
These improve hydration and support mature skin.
Skin Barrier Repair Ingredients
- Ceramides
- Panthenol
- Centella asiatica
- Colloidal oatmeal
- Amino acids
These help repair dryness, redness, and irritation.

How to Apply Night Cream for Best Results
Follow these steps for maximum benefits.
Step 1: Cleanse Skin
Wash away dirt, oil, and makeup.
Step 2: Apply Serum
Optional serums:
- Retinol
- Vitamin C
- Hyaluronic acid
Step 3: Apply Night Cream
Massage evenly onto:
- Face
- Neck
- Jawline
Step 4: Use Daily
Consistency gives better long-term results.
Words & Meanings
| Word |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Aging Skin | Skin showing signs of ageing, like wrinkles, dryness, and loss of firmness. |
| Night Cream | A moisturiser designed to repair and nourish skin overnight. |
| Wrinkles | Deep lines or folds that develop as skin ages. |
| Fine Lines | Small shallow lines that appear early during ageing. |
| Retinol | A vitamin A derivative that helps reduce wrinkles and improve skin texture. |
| Ceramides | Lipids that strengthen the skin barrier and lock in moisture. |
| Peptides | Amino acid chains that support collagen production and skin firmness. |
| Hyaluronic Acid | A hydrating ingredient that helps skin retain moisture. |
| Antioxidants | Compounds that protect skin from environmental damage and premature ageing. |
| Skin Barrier | The outer protective layer of skin that prevents moisture loss. |
| Hyperpigmentation | Dark patches or uneven skin tone caused by excess melanin. |
| Collagen | A protein that keeps skin firm, smooth, and youthful. |
| Firming | Improving skin elasticity and reducing sagging. |
| Hydration | Maintaining moisture levels in the skin. |
| Mature Skin | Skin with visible ageing signs, usually common after age 40. |
